About Panorama by Precision Planting

Viewing and transferring data out of the cab is not always simple. With Panorama® you can easily view maps, input summaries, and agronomic data from a Gen 3 20|20. See all your 20|20 data on your phone, computer, or platform of your choice.

Each step of the crop cycle must have accurate data to guide future decisions. Whether you’re stopping in the field to make a fix, evaluating your approach for the next pass, or choosing your purchases for next season, you need accurate data.

The Gen 3 20|20 not only controls your equipment but is the hub for agronomic data and performance metrics from Precision Planting products. The best part about the 20|20 is that it isn’t just for planters. Use it to control and monitor your sprayer, combine, seeder, and fertilizer applicator, then view results in the Panorama platform.

By connecting to Wi-Fi, the Gen 3 20|20 will automatically push data to Panorama so you can access it on the app when you’re ready to review.

Panorama Review – Version 4.5

With the release of version 4.5, Panorama has made meaningful progress in harvest tracking. Under Coverage, the software now properly displays totals of all machines combined, which is a big improvement. This update helps provide a more accurate picture of overall progress when multiple machines are working in the same field. That said, a few key areas still need attention: 1. Harvest Tab Aggregation While Coverage totals are now correct, the Harvest tab still does not aggregate machine data correctly. When multiple machine passes are selected, the metrics (area covered, yield, moisture, and others) should reflect combined totals and averages. For example, area covered should be the sum of all machines, while yield and moisture should reflect averages across machines. Currently, the Harvest tab only reflects totals from one primary machine, ignoring that multiple machines are selected. These combined metrics need to function the same way they do under Coverage. 2. Hybrid Totals vs. Field Totals The homepage includes a helpful Hybrid Totals card, but there should also be a Field Totals card option. Most growers track performance metrics on a per-field basis, not strictly per hybrid. A “Field-First” card would display each field name as the card title (sortable alphabetically by filter/sort), with hybrid, acres planted/harvested, moisture, yield, and related stats shown underneath. The data already exists in Panorama but is locked in a hybrid-first view. Presenting it in a field-first view would better match how operations are managed. 3. Landing Page Simplification The home page still needs streamlining to make quick glances more useful. Under Recent Activity, if multiple machines are in the same field, their activity should be combined into one entry instead of listed separately. Additionally, whether a machine is planting or harvesting, it would be valuable to see simple metrics at a glance, such as current field, acres remaining, average yield, and average moisture. This would give operators and managers a fast, accurate snapshot for planning logistics like truck scheduling, bin capacity, and crew timing. Closing Thought Version 4.5 demonstrates clear progress with Coverage aggregation, but extending these fixes into the Harvest tab, adding a field-first card view, and simplifying the landing page would unlock even greater usability. Precision has the data right; now the presentation just needs refinement to match real-world farm workflows. It’s good to see Precision listening to their customers, as each update shows clear improvement.
